Create Database Link ( DBlink ) in Oracle

Database link ( Dblink ) is used for connection between 2 different Oracle database. You can query any table from Remote database using DBLink in Oracle database.

To use dblink, you need to create database link in target database like following.

CREATE public DATABASE LINK PRODLINK CONNECT TO mehmet IDENTIFIED BY mehmet USING '192.168.63.34:1521/DEVECI';

You can query crm.customers table which is in '192.168.63.34:1521/DEVECI' database like following.

select * from [email protected];

This Database link (Prodlink) will connect to '192.168.63.34:1521/DEVECI' via mehmet user and query database objects from remote database ( '192.168.63.34:1521/DEVECI' ).

You can create database links both Public and Private. When you create database link as private, then just related user can use it. If database link is created as public, then everyone can use it.

You can create private dblink with TNS like following.

CREATE DATABASE LINK DB_LINK CONNECT TO mehmet IDENTIFIED BY mehmet USING '(DESCRIPTION=(ADDRESS_LIST=(ADDRESS=(PROTOCOL=TCP) (HOST=192.168.63.34)(PORT=1521))) (CONNECT_DATA=(SERVER = DEDICATED)(SID = DEVECI)) )';

Create Database Link Privilege in Oracle

If you want to give Create Database Link Privilige to any user, you can do it as follows.

grant CREATE DATABASE LINK to username;    SQL> grant CREATE DATABASE LINK to mehmet;  Grant succeeded.  SQL>

You can also use "select insert" using dblink like following from remote database to source database.

insert into crm.customers select * from [email protected] where createdat>sysdate-3; commit;

You can query count of crm.customers table which is in the  like following.

select count(*) from [email protected]_LINK;              

Drop Database Link

You can drop any database link as follows.

drop DATABASE LINK dblink_name;  SQL> drop DATABASE LINK READ_LINK;
